Origin & Meaning

AI-Written
Formed in nineteenth-century America by pairing the Germanic root Lou with the Latinate diminutive suffix -ella. It was built during the late Victorian vogue for fluid, vowel-heavy coinages. The name spread widely across rural county ledgers before fading in the mid-twentieth century.
Also answers toLou, Lulu, Ella

Field Notes

AI-Written
Field Note 01
The name reached its historical high-water mark in 1918, when 949 newborn girls received it.
Field Note 02
About forty-two percent of all living Luellas belong to Generation Alpha, while another twenty-one percent belong to the Silent Generation.
Field Note 03
With roughly thirty-three thousand bearers recorded since 1880, it remained a regional standby rather than a national juggernaut.
